It goes without saying that last year’s Ghost Max was a surprising standout in the field. No one really expected it to be as good as it was, so that left expectations high when it came to what the Ghost Max 2 might look like. The answer is interesting because it does retain a bit of the original, but it has been stiffened up a tad, consumerized definitely, especially in the upper, but to us it is still a better shoe than the standard Ghost and we prefer it for daily miles. Read on to see why and if it might just be a better fit for you as well.
Technical Specs
- Weight – 10.8oz or 306g for a US Men’s 9, 9.5oz or 269g for a US Women’s 7
- Cushion – 39mm of cushion and a 6mm heel/toe drop
- Pricing – $150 USD
- Colors – 9 colors
Upper
The upper of the Brooks Ghost Max 2 continues the trend of comfort and support with a plush, high-quality construction. The use of soft yet durable mesh ensures breathability, keeping feet cool even during longer runs. The fit is snug but not too tight, providing ample room without leading to any hot spots or pressure points. This model’s lacing system and overlays enhance the fit, maintaining a secure lock-in feel that supports each stride. The design, available in multiple colorways, ensures runners can find something that appeals aesthetically as well.




Midsole
Brooks has upped their game with the introduction of the nitrogen-infused DNA Loft V3 midsole in the Ghost Max 2. This cushioning delivers a softer underfoot feel compared to its predecessor while ensuring a responsive ride. The combination of plush cushioning and gentle resilience absorbs shock effectively, aiding in smoother transitions from heel to toe. This midsole strikes a fine balance, making it ideal for both recovery days and longer, steady runs. It is slightly firmer than the original Max, but not in a bad way.


Outsole
The outsole of the Ghost Max 2 is designed with durability and traction in mind. Featuring a robust rubber compound, it offers excellent grip on various road surfaces. The tread pattern is strategically designed to provide stability, ensuring confident strides even on wet or uneven pavement. While the overall composition remains largely unchanged, the outsole continues to be a dependable aspect, promising longevity and consistent performance.

Performance During the Run
Lacing up the Ghost Max 2, it quickly becomes apparent why this shoe is a favored choice for maximally cushioned road miles. During short runs, the shoe maintains a comfortable and responsive ride, while longer distances further emphasize the plush support of the DNA Loft V3 midsole. The slightly firmer feel compared to the original Ghost Max enhances the run without compromising on cushioning, providing a smooth and stable experience across various speeds. Whether dealing with recovery runs or regular training sessions, the Ghost Max 2 adapts well, supporting varied running styles without significant fatigue.

Conclusion
The Brooks Ghost Max 2 successfully brings a softer yet resilient approach to the max-cushion category. With its well-constructed upper, advanced midsole technology, and dependable outsole, it serves as a versatile option for many runners. The slight increase in weight and somewhat basic aesthetics might not thrill everyone, yet the overall performance and comfort shouldn’t be overlooked.
